Default How do I install Non-Default Skintones?
Hey Simmers,

I've been looking for information on how to install non-default skintones for Sims 3 everywhere, but when I find a good post, the links in the post (which give more information..) no longer work.
I really want to install cc skintones, but I just don't know how to install them.
Right now they all are in the downloads folder (Documents\Electronic Arts\The Sims 3\Downloads), but they don't seem to appear in either the launcher or the game itself.
I have no idea what to do next, since I've already looked on so many pages!
Also, I want to make sure I want NON-DEFAULT skintones, because I want to keep the originals.

I believe that skintones always come in package based format. If so, they must be installed the same way as other package files like mods, not by using the Downloads folder and the Launcher -- that's only for sims3packs.

Install them the same way you'd install any other CC. If they're sims3packs, put them in Downloads then find them in the Launcher and hit the install button. If they're .package files, put them in Mods/Packages. Game Help:Sims 3 CC Basicswiki
